Purpose

Help agents decide when and whether to use Claude Code's native cron scheduler (CronCreate/CronList/CronDelete) versus alternatives like OS cron (crontab), GitHub Actions scheduled workflows, or simple one-shot Task() delegation.

Using the wrong scheduling mechanism leads to:

  • Silent task loss (session expiry kills CronCreate tasks)
  • Missed precision requirements (CronCreate has up to 15-min jitter)
  • Over-engineering (using GitHub Actions for a simple session heartbeat)

Quick Checklist (Run Before Any Scheduling Decision)

Answer these 5 questions in order. The FIRST "yes" that hits a stop condition determines your tool.

  1. Is the task a one-time operation?

    • YES → Use TaskCreate or Task(). Stop here. CronCreate is for recurring work only.
  2. Must the task survive terminal/session close?

    • YES → Use OS cron (crontab -e) or GitHub Actions. CronCreate is session-scoped and dies when Claude Code closes.
  3. Does the task require sub-15-minute precision or hard time guarantees?

    • YES → Use OS cron or GitHub Actions. CronCreate fires with up to 10% jitter (max 15 min).
  4. Is this a heartbeat loop or session-scoped health check?

    • YES → Use CronCreate. This is its primary intended use case.
  5. Is this triggered by an event rather than a clock?

    • YES → Use a hook (PreToolUse/PostToolUse) or an event listener, not a scheduler at all.

Decision Matrix

Scenario Recommended Tool Reason
Periodic background monitoring during active session CronCreate Session-scoped is fine; this is CronCreate's primary use case
Agent ecosystem heartbeat (health checks, memory sizes) CronCreate via heartbeat-orchestrator Use dedicated orchestrator, not raw CronCreate
One-time task (now or delayed) Task() or TaskCreate Cron is for recurring work only
Nightly backup or data pipeline OS cron (crontab -e) Must survive terminal close
CI/CD pipeline trigger GitHub Actions schedule: Cloud-run, no terminal dependency
Data refresh every 4 hours during development CronCreate Session-scoped is acceptable for dev workflows
Production scheduled job OS cron or GitHub Actions Never rely on session-scoped for production
Event-driven reaction (file change, hook trigger) Hook (PreToolUse/PostToolUse) Time-based scheduler is wrong tool for events
User-requested one-off analysis Task() Single execution, no recurrence needed
Weekly report generation (must run unattended) GitHub Actions Unattended, cloud-run, persistent
Session index rebuild during development CronCreate Session-scoped is fine; fires while Claude is open
Reflection queue drain check CronCreate via heartbeat-orchestrator Part of heartbeat ecosystem

CronCreate Constraints (Critical Before Using)

Constraint Detail
Session-scoped Dies when terminal closes — no persistence across restarts
3-day auto-expiry Self-deletes silently after 3 days (reschedule before day 2.5)
Jitter Fires up to 10% of period late (max 15 min)
No catch-up Missed fires are NOT replayed
50-task cap Max 50 concurrent scheduled tasks per session
Fire-between-turns Fires only when Claude is idle, not mid-response
No extended syntax L, W, ?, MON-style names are NOT supported

When to Use Each Tool

Use CronCreate when

  • Task is session-scoped (acceptable to lose on terminal close)
  • Monitoring, health checks, or periodic index refreshes during active development
  • 15-minute jitter is acceptable
  • Task fits within the 50-task session cap (stay under 10 for headroom)

Use OS cron (crontab -e) when

  • Task must run even when Claude Code is closed
  • Sub-minute precision is required
  • Production data pipelines, backups, or server maintenance

Use GitHub Actions schedule: when

  • Task must run unattended in CI/CD environment
  • Fully cloud-run with no terminal dependency
  • Cross-repo or deployment-related scheduling
  • Audit trail and run history are required

Use Task() or TaskCreate when

  • One-time execution (even if delayed)
  • Event-driven (not time-driven)

Use a hook when

  • Triggered by a tool call event (PreToolUse/PostToolUse), not a clock

Quick Reference: CronCreate API

// Schedule a recurring task (standard 5-field cron expression)
CronCreate({ schedule: '*/30 * * * *', task: 'Heartbeat check prompt here' });

// List active cron tasks (verify what is registered)
CronList();

// Remove a scheduled task by ID
CronDelete({ id: 'abc12345' });

Common schedules:

Expression Meaning
*/30 * * * * Every 30 minutes
*/5 * * * * Every 5 minutes (minimum recommended)
0 * * * * Every hour on the hour
0 2 * * * Every day at 2am local time
0 3 * * 0 Every Sunday at 3am
